[quote:Anonymous Coward 27662195:MV8yMDYyNTU4XzM0NzYxODI2X0RBM0E2QjI2] [quote:tarfonwxx:MV8yMDYyNTU4XzM0NzYxNjYyX0IzQTU0NzMx] thank you AC for the links! :hf: The atmospheric mechanisms behind the storms of 1861-62 are unknown; however, the storms were [b]likely the result of an intense atmospheric river[/b], or a series of atmospheric rivers, striking the U.S. West Coast. [b]With the right preconditions, just one intense atmospheric river hitting the Sierra Nevada mountain range east of Sacramento could bring devastation to the Central Valley of California[/b]. An independent panel wrote in October 2007 to California’s Department of Water Resources, “California’s Central Valley faces significant flood risks. [b]Many experts feel that the Central Valley is the next big disaster waiting to happen[/b]. This fast-growing region in the country’s most populous state, the Central Valley encompasses the [b]floodplains of two major rivers—the Sacramento and the San Joaquin[/b]—as well as additional rivers and tributaries that drain the Sierra Nevada.
